### Step 2: Rebuild the Autocomplete Index

Before cutting over, rebuild Swiftfind's autocomplete index with the new prefix-tree format. The rebuild runs online and typically takes forty minutes; old queries keep working throughout. Do not skip the verification pass — a partial index silently returns empty results. Once verification reports green, apply the settings below to the query nodes.

config for bawig-fadup:
[zorix]
host = zorix.lumicworks.corp
user = zorix_svc
database = zorix_prod

// Client setup for the Gallery Companion audio-guide app (Halverton Museum of
// Curiosities pilot). This client talks to our internal exhibit-metadata service,
// which resolves room beacons to narration tracks. Note for security review:
// transport is TLS 1.3 only, retries are capped at three, and responses are
// validated against the published schema before caching. The key is scoped
// read-only to the exhibits namespace and rotates every 90 days via the
// Keyloom scheduler. The current key for the exhibit-metadata service follows.

API key for tagef-fafop: vxb2-ta

Handover Note – Director Transition, Quellmark Foods

Welcome aboard. The Southvale expansion is at a delicate stage: leases are signed for two distribution hubs, but local licensing in Harrow Fen remains pending. Keep weekly contact with the regional counsel and do not commit capital beyond the approved tranche until permits clear. Staffing plans are drafted but unconfirmed. Please review the confidential note appended directly below this handover.

management briefing: Only 5 of the 80 pilot accounts renewed Zorix, so a churn review is set for October 1.

Support should know the symptoms: English fallbacks appearing only on large, recently edited screens. The fix adds a hard failure when any file is skipped, plus a report the script emits after each run so support can verify coverage before escalating to engineering. The caps and timeouts the script enforces are defined by the following constants.

tuning constants:
RATE_LIMITS = {
    "wenwyn": 1,
    "zorix": 10,
    "oliix": 2,
    "holael": 10,
}